About Sitpholek Institute of Muay Thai Techniques

Sitpholek Institute of Muay Thai Techniques is an established fight camp on Soi Khao Talo in Bang Lamung, with more than 25 years of training experience behind it. Alongside traditional Muay Thai it teaches Western boxing, MMA and Lethwei (Burmese boxing), giving guests an unusually broad striking syllabus under one roof.

The camp is run by Frank Sitpholek , who is also the promoter behind Pattaya Boxing World — so members train in a place with genuine connections to the local fight scene. Sessions run in the morning and again in the afternoon, with the per-session price including use of the on-site weights gym.

Because Sitpholek has its own dorm rooms with en-suite bathrooms, WiFi and an on-site restaurant, it works well as a training base where you can stay, eat and train in one place. It holds a 4.8 rating across 29 reviews.
